IN SERVICE

NAVY AIRMAN RECRUIT RUSSELL D. HUGGETT, son of Diann M. Huggett of Roanoke, is in the Persian Gulf aboard the aircraft carrier USS Kitty Hawk, based in San Diego.

The Kitty Hawk has been part of Operation Southern Watch, enforcing a no-fly zone over southern Iraq.

Huggett, a 1991 graduate of Salem High School, also served recently off the coast of Somalia with the relief effort Operation Restore Hope.
